The Bloch Women's Splitflex T-Strap Character Shoe is designed with both aesthetics and functionality in mind. This shoe features a T-strap silhouette that not only looks elegant but also provides the necessary support for your dance movements. The shorter shank, combined with an elastic panel, allows for enhanced pointe work while maintaining flexibility. It’s an ideal choice for dancers looking to combine style with performance.

These shoes are well made, comfortable and look great on stage… BUT they do not offer adequate ankle support for musical theatre dancing. I have these shoes in both the tan and black and I only wear them when performing in shows that don’t require dancing. They feel very wobbly on jumps or turns when you may need to put any weight on the back of your foot. Heel strikes are impossible. I would never wear them again to dance. But in a show, play or scene when I am just walking or have simple movement they work well and are very comfortable and elegant looking.

I am a beginning dancer about to start a musical theatre conservatory. I needed a pair of character shoes to wear for shows and dance class. I have previously only worn character shoes without elastic, like the Capezio Manhattans. I wasn’t a big fan of those because they felt slippery and clunky.I was a little scared to purchase these because some reviewers said they felt unsafe and unstable and didn't recommend them for those who are not advanced dancers. However, I was pleasantly surprised when they arrived, as they don’t feel unstable at all IMO. I immediately ran around my house in them and felt secure the whole time. I also really like the suede bottoms.I wear a street shoe size 7.5 and have a normal width foot with a narrow heel. I ordered an 8, which fits well. The only thing I don’t like is that the ankle strap is comically long. I have to tighten it to the tightest hole to fit my ankles, but then the strap sticks way out and looks a little ridiculous.
